Hey support folks — the PuzzleSmith crossword generator stopped pulling clue suggestions this morning. Turns out the credential for the LexiRank internal service expired over the weekend, so every grid build fails at the clue-scoring step. Nothing's actually broken in the generator itself. I've provisioned a fresh replacement already; please update the shared config with the key below.

API key for yahig-tadup: kto7_ubizbYm

Ticket: Dedup pipeline for Marnwell customer records halted mid-run. The merge workers in the Ostbridge environment were started with the dry-run template, so match scores are computed but no records are consolidated, and the release gate on duplicate counts will fail tonight. About 40k candidate pairs are queued. We need the workers restarted with write access to the golden-record store before the cutoff. The fix is a one-line change: append the line below to the worker env file and cycle the pods.

secret setting of yajog-taguf: ARCHIVE_KEY3=051

# Order-cutoff enforcement for the Crumbline bakery client.
# All same-day orders must be rejected after 11:00 local time per the
# Flourhouse fulfillment agreement. The cutoff check runs server-side in
# the Ovenward service, so this client only surfaces the error; do not
# add a local clock check here, as store timezones vary. The client
# below authenticates against Ovenward's staging tier. Use the key on
# the next line when initializing the session.

gateway credential: kto23_LX9A4ys6i4nzHtpOLNLodKK

- [ ] Key ceremony, item 4 (eng sync): Rotate encryption key for the Quillsearch autocomplete index. Context: index rebuilds are slow (~40 min), so rotation must happen during the low-traffic window or suggestions degrade. Two custodians required; old key stays live until reindex completes, then revoke. Verify shard checksums post-rotation. Known issue: warm-cache eviction spikes latency briefly — expected, don't roll back. Log completion in the ceremony sheet. Custodians should then record the recovery passphrase below.

unlock words, kawig-bawef: belax-sorir-druax-ulaiel-wenael-belael